logging: add more terse .set()

This commit is contained in:
NullBite 2023-07-02 00:01:44 -04:00
parent 33d6ecaa03
commit 0d06fb0c3c
Signed by: nullbite
GPG Key ID: 6C4D545385D4925A

View File

@ -16,11 +16,18 @@ end
-- default log level -- default log level
local loglevel="INFO" local loglevel="INFO"
function logging.setLogLevel(level) function logging.set(level)
loglevel=loglevels[level] and level or loglevel loglevel=loglevels[level] and level or loglevel
end end
logging.setLogLevel("INFO") ---deprecated wrapper for logging.set, it is intentionally a wrapper instead of
--an alias because LuaLS docs don't work without doing this
---@deprecated user logging.set instead, more terse
function logging.setLogLevel(level)
return logging.set(level)
end
logging.set("INFO")
local function printLog(severity, ...) local function printLog(severity, ...)
if (loglevels[loglevel]) >= severity then if (loglevels[loglevel]) >= severity then